Srinagar: The Enforcement squad of Food, Civil Supplies and Consumer Affairs (FCS&CA) Monday recovered Rs 7600 fine from 21 erring shopkeepers for violation of the Essential Commodities Act, 1955.
As per an official handout issued here, the market checking squad headed by Assistant Director Enforcement North and South zones inspected 69 business establishments in FathKadal, Raitang, Hazaribazar, KaniKadal, KaranagarGole market, Balgardern Kakasari adjoining areas in the Srinagar City, where the erring traders were fined for violating norms.
